Evaluation: 2 major exams,
2 quizzes, and 10 assignments comprise 85% of the final mark; the lab component accounts for 15% of the final grade. The final course mark is normally calculated in the following way:
Assignments 10 %
2 quizzes 20 %
Mid-year exam 20 %
Final exam 35 %
Lab 15 %
100 %
The lecture component (85%) and the lab component (15%) must
each be passed
separately in order to receive a passing grade for the course. The
passing grade for the lab is 65%. In addition, if a student fails to complete more than
3 labs (for whatever reason), a failing grade will be assigned for the course. A complete lab means carrying out the designated procedure and submitting a completed lab
report for that procedure.
